WebJun 1, 2013 · index but Fisher (1911; 388) was the first to realize that once the price index was determined, then equation (5) could be used to determine the companion quantity index. 15 WebFrom Table 1, the Fisher Ideal index using price weights from 1992 for the Laspeyres component and 1993 for the Paasche component has a value of 102.32, so that growth was 2.32 percent between 1992 and 1993. A Fisher Ideal link index using price weights from 1993 and 1994 would have been 103.47, meaning that growth from 1993 to 1994 was …

WebApr 13, 2024 · Index that is based on the linking (chaining) of indexes to create a time series. Annual chained-type Fisher indices are used in BEA's national income and product accounts (NIPAs) whereby Fisher ideal price indices are calculated using the weights of adjacent years. WebThe Fisher Ideal index is the geometric average of a Laspeyres and Paasche indexes for the same time period. The geometric average is calculated by multiplying the Laspeyres index by the Paasche index and then taking the square root of the result.
